The 'Kobo Libra H2O' is my top pick—it’s not just waterproof (IPX8 rated, meaning it can survive underwater for up to 60 mins!), but also lightweight and compact. The 7-inch screen is perfect for one-handed reading, and the ergonomic design makes it comfortable to hold for hours.
Another great option is the 'Kindle Paperwhite' (11th gen), which is also IPX8 rated. It’s slightly smaller than the Kobo but packs a punch with its crisp display and adjustable warm light. I love taking it to the beach because the glare-free screen works perfectly in sunlight. Both e-readers support audiobooks and have long battery life, so you can binge-read without worrying about frequent charges. I can tell you that discounts on the largest e-readers—like the Kindle Oasis or Kobo Libra H2O—do pop up occasionally, especially during major sales events like Amazon Prime Day, Black Friday, or holiday seasons. I snagged my Oasis last year at a 20% discount during a Prime Day flash sale.
Aside from seasonal promotions, keep an eye on refurbished models. Amazon’s refurbished Kindle store often has the Oasis at a steep discount, and they come with warranties. I’ve also seen bundles where the e-reader is paired with a case or credits for eBooks, which adds value. If you’re not in a rush, setting up price alerts on CamelCamelCamel or Honey can help track drops. Book lovers might also want to check out Rakuten for Kobo discounts, as they frequently offer cashback deals on top of existing sales.

I can say that e-book readers are devices designed specifically for reading digital books. They use e-ink technology, which mimics the appearance of paper and reduces eye strain, making them perfect for long reading sessions. Unlike tablets, they focus solely on reading, with features like adjustable font sizes, built-in dictionaries, and long battery life. I love how portable they are—I can carry hundreds of books in one slim device. Popular models include Amazon's Kindle, Kobo, and Nook. They often have backlights for night reading and sync progress across devices, so I can switch from my e-reader to my phone seamlessly. For book lovers, they’re a game-changer, offering convenience without sacrificing the joy of reading.
Another great thing about e-book readers is their access to vast digital libraries. Many support formats like EPUB and PDF, and some even let you borrow books from public libraries. I appreciate how lightweight they are compared to physical books, especially when traveling. The lack of distractions like notifications makes them ideal for immersive reading. Some models even have waterproofing, so I don’t have to worry about reading by the pool. While they’ll never replace the feel of a physical book for some, the practicality and features make them a must-have for avid readers.

I love reading by the pool or at the beach, so I totally get the need for a waterproof e-reader. Right now, there aren’t many color e-readers that are fully waterproof, but there are some great options if you’re willing to compromise. The 'Onyx Boox Tab Ultra C' is a fantastic color e-reader with high-resolution display, but it’s not waterproof. If waterproofing is a must, the 'Kobo Libra 2' is waterproof and has a crisp e-ink screen, though it’s only in grayscale. Hopefully, we’ll see more color waterproof models soon, as the demand is definitely there among book lovers like me who enjoy reading in all kinds of environments.
